网络讨论平台的设计与实现
图6-11后台管理界面
1、版面管理功能测试
版面的管理功能主要有分区的添加、修改、删除,版面的添加、修改、删除。主要测试版面的添加和修改删除功能。
添加版面的界面如图6-12所示。
图6-12版面添加界面
选择分区和输入版面名称以及版面描述后,点击添加按钮,出现添加成功提示框,点击确定后,系统显示版面管理界面(点击版面管理按钮也出现此页),罗列出了平台所有的主题分类版面,如图6-13所示。版面管理主要是管理主题版面,对现有的主题版面进行修改和删除。
26
四川理工学院本科毕业论文
图6-13版面管理界面
2、用户信息管理功能测试
用户信息管理主要是对注册用户权限等级进行设定,同时也可对注册用户的密码进行重置,查看注册用户的资料信息,另外还可删除该用户。点击用户的权限等级设置,其界面如图6-14所示,可选择分区、普通、总版主三个等级,任选一个等级,点击确定出现设定成功提示框;点击用户信息管理界面的删除按钮,出现“确定删除吗?”的对话提示框,点击确定后系统提示删除成功;点击重设密码按钮,系统出现“密码被重置为123456”的对话提示框。
图6-14用户权限设置界面
3、主题管理功能测试
主题信息管理可对平台主题进行内容编辑、主题的置顶、精华的设定以及删除,点击“编辑”按钮,进入主题内容编辑界面,编辑后点击“修改”按钮,弹出修改成功对话框;点击“置顶”按钮,出现置顶操作界面,点击“置顶”成功置顶该主题;点击“删除”按钮,弹出确认对话框,点击确定即成功删除。
主题回复信息的管理主要是对回复信息进行编辑和删除,其测试过程与方法同主题信息管理的测试相同,不在赘述。
27
网络讨论平台的设计与实现
6.3 测试结论
通过对游客注册和用户登录,主题的发表及回复,主题的搜索,后台管理功能的测试,测试结果符合最初设计的要求,界面简洁美观,操作简便,符合一般用户的使用要求。
6.4 本章小结
本章主要叙述了系统测试的目的和方法,测试的主要内容,测试结果的分析,其中重点介绍了对游客注册、用户登录、主题发表回复、主题搜索、后台管理等功能模块的测试。
28
四川理工学院本科毕业论文
第七章 结束语
通过本次对网络讨论平台的设计,掌握了动态网页的设计思路和开发流程,在设计中采用了Asp.net技术对整个界面进行详细的设计和制作,采用SQL数据库来存储平台的数据和信息。设计中综合的运用了Microsoft visual studio 2005和微软SQL Server 2005两种功能强大的软件来辅助设计,成功实现了与数据库的连接,并完成系统功能的设计和测试。
网络讨论平台实现了用户的注册,主题的发表回复,个人信息管理等一些功能,也实现了后台对主题的信息管理,以及对用户信息的管理等,同时在平台中额外添加了一个最新资讯小模块,让用户能够及时了解最新信息,平台简界面简洁美观,操作简便。
此次设计基本达到了预期的要求,实现了相应的功能,但是由于设计经验不足和时间的仓促,设计中仍有一些考虑不周到的地方需要改进,在以后的日子里,还会不断精益求精,使设计不断完善,功能更加简单实用。
虽然时间紧迫,但此次设计还是成功的完成了,在设计中不仅锻炼了自己的能力,也为以后的工作和学习积累了宝贵的经验,可以说,在这次设计中,学到了不少东西,尤其是对软件工程和微软NET平台的相关技术做了以比较深入的探索。
29
网络讨论平台的设计与实现
致 谢
从论文的开始到顺利完成,虽然充满了艰辛,但同时也伴随着快乐,这期间一直都离不开父母、老师、同学以及朋友对我的种种支持和帮助,最是感激不尽,在这里请接受我诚挚的谢意。
首先,感谢我的指导老师李晓花老师,在整个毕业设计期间,都凝结了李老师的精心指导和细心检查,李老师精益求精的工作作风和一丝不苟的治学态度都给我留下了深刻的印象,也值得我一生受用,毕业论文的点点滴滴都离不开您的悉心的辅导,在论文的最后我要借此机会特别向您表示感谢,谢谢您的指导!
其次,要感谢所有的老师,是他们传授给我了宝贵知识,是他们使我学会了奋斗与拼搏,同样是他们使我懂得了坚强与自信,他们在我的大学期间付出了很多的心血与精力,在我的学习道路中,他们孜孜不倦的教诲和鼓舞是促进我不断进取的重要精神动力。
特别要感谢我含辛茹苦的父母,感谢他们对我学业的理解与支持!
最后,我要感谢在这次设计中,帮助和支持我的同学以及朋友,谢谢你们!!!
30